University spin-out Fieldwork Robotics is developing the world’s first autonomous raspberry harvesting robot. Designed to harvest at the same quality as the average fruit picker and to significantly boost the productivity of growers, the technology combines cutting-edge hardware and software to create highly advanced harvesting robots that provide growers with efficient, cost-effective, and sustainable harvesting solutions. We lead the market globally in the robotic harvesting of fresh raspberries and have strong commercial partnerships with key raspberry industry players in our target markets to support our product development.
